What is the technique for knowledge?
The technique for knowledge involves seeking out information from various sources, critically analyzing and evaluating that information, and then synthesizing it into a coherent understanding. This process may include reading, research, experimentation, and discussion with others. It also requires an open mind, a willingness to challenge assumptions, and the ability to adapt one's understanding as new information becomes available. Ultimately, the technique for knowledge is an ongoing and dynamic process of learning and growth.

What is the best learning technique?
The best learning technique varies from person to person as everyone has different learning styles and preferences. However, some effective learning techniques include active learning, such as practicing and applying what you have learned, teaching others the material, and using mnemonic devices to aid memory retention. It is important to experiment with different techniques to find what works best for you and to stay consistent with your learning habits.

Which click technique?
The "which click technique" refers to the method of clicking a computer mouse or trackpad. There are several different techniques for clicking, including single-click, double-click, and right-click. The appropriate technique to use depends on the specific action you want to perform. For example, a single-click is typically used to select an item, while a double-click is often used to open a file or launch a program. Right-clicking brings up a context menu with additional options. It's important to use the correct click technique to effectively navigate and interact with a computer interface.

What is graphic technique?
Graphic technique refers to the methods and processes used to create visual art and design. This can include drawing, painting, printmaking, digital illustration, and other forms of visual communication. Graphic techniques can involve the use of various tools and materials, such as pencils, pens, brushes, and digital software, to create images and designs that convey a specific message or aesthetic. These techniques are often used in fields such as advertising, publishing, and web design to create visually engaging and impactful content.

What is keyboard technique?
Keyboard technique refers to the physical skills and coordination required to play a keyboard instrument, such as a piano or organ. This includes proper hand and finger placement, posture, and movement, as well as the ability to play with speed, accuracy, and expression. Developing good keyboard technique is essential for playing with ease and fluency, and it allows the musician to convey their musical ideas effectively. It involves a combination of physical dexterity, muscle memory, and understanding of musical principles.
